Fear Domain
Deities: Zon-Kuthon, Rovagug, Phobos (Greek)
Granted Powers: You are well-acquainted with fear and, thus, are resistant to its effects. You receive a bonus equal to half your cleric level (minimum 1) to all Will saves against fear effects.
Touch of Terror: As a melee touch attack, you can cause a creature to gain the shaken condition for one round. Creatures with more Hit Dice than your cleric level are unaffected. You can use this ability a number of times equal to 3 + your Wisdom modifier.
Feed on Fear:* At 8th level, as an immediate action upon successfully hitting a creature with a melee attack that's already suffering from a fear effect, you deal 2d6 extra points of damage and gain that amount in temporary hit points. These temporary hit points last for 24 hours or until lost. You can use this ability once per day at 8th level, and an additional time per day for every 4 levels beyond 8th.
Domain spells: 1st-cause fear, 2nd-scare, 3rd-hold person, 4th-fear, 5th-nightmare, 6th-symbol of fear, 7th-insanity, 8th-mass fear**, 9th-weird

*The Feed on Fear ability is not my own work but that of Paizo, as borrowed from the fear subdomain from Inner Sea Gods. All credit goes to them.
**The 8th level domain spell mass fear is not an actual Paizo spell as far as I can find. I've never tried it. I have no idea if it's truly balanced or not. I just looked at daze and mass daze and saw that they are 4 spell levels apart so, by the same reasoning, I thought a mass fear spell could be 4 steps above fear. Shaken for one round seems like a horribly weak effect for using a standard action. For reference, that's what happens to someone when they makes their save against the Cause Fear spell. I suppose if you have another non-demoralize way to make them shaken, you can stack it to Frightened, but otherwise it seems pretty useless.
